During this time I managed to climb a snowy and steep mountain called Assiniboine. It's nickname is "The Mattahorn of the Rockies". I travelled more than 60km and spent 16 straight hours climbing to make it from the hut I was staying in to the summit and back. I had a BLAST and met 4 really cool people. </description>
